The 3 Essentials for Long-Term Health and Vitality
from The Balancing Point Podcast · host John Nieters
In this episode of The Balancing Point, I sit down with David Stouder to discuss what it really takes to age well. We explore the role of nutrition, lifestyle, and supplementation, and why vitamin D, omega-3s, and gut health are foundational for long-term vitality.
